Notes to Editors About Shell Coal Gasification Process (SCGP)
Shell has over 30 years of experience worldwide in developing and commercializing coal gasification technology, which turns coal into syngas to produce chemicals, or for use in power generation.
Shell has 19 coal gasification technology licensing agreements with Chinese users. Among the licensees, 11 plants have started up, including the Yueyang coal gasification plant in Hunan province in which Shell is an equity partner with Sinopec.
Shell has established a dedicated clean coal service team in Beijing to provide Chinese clients with technical services supporting their plants’ commissioning, start-up, operation, and efficiency enhancement.
Shanghai Marine Diesel Engine Research Institution (SMDERI) of China Shipbuilding Industry Corporation was qualified in May to produce the coal burner, a core component of Shell coal gasification applications.
Shell has also partnered with Chinese institutes and universities on 15 joint clean coal technology research and development projects.
About the three local manufacturers
Dongfang Boiler Group Co., Ltd. (DBC), established in 1966 and based in Zigong city of Sichuan Province, is a subsidiary of Dongfang Electric Group Company Limited, which is held by Dongfang Electric Corporation. DBC’s main business scope covers designing and manufacturing thermal power equipment, auxiliaries for power plant, large chemical vessels, and environmental protection equipment for power plants as well as large nuclear power equipment for clients at home and abroad. Over the last 40 years, DBC has developed into one of China’s largest export and manufacturing bases for thermal power equipment, a national first class enterprise and a key state-owned enterprise with an annual turnover of more than RMB10 billion.
Wuxi Huaguang Boiler Co., Ltd. in Wuxi city, Jiangsu Province, was reformed from its predecessor Wuxi Boiler Works founded in 1958. It is listed on the Shanghai Stock Exchange, and specialises in manufacturing boilers for power plants, industry boilers, pressure vessels, flue gas desulphurisation and purification equipment,heat recovery steam generators, boilers for garbage treatment, and water treatment equipment. Suzhou Hailu Heavy Industry Co., Ltd. was reformed from its predecessor Shazhou Marine Boiler Factory founded in 1956. Now the company is listed on the Shenzhen Stock Exchange. It is the only company in China that can produce both marine and land-based boilers. The company produces ten series of equipment with more than 180 categories including industry boilers, electric heating atmospheric boilers, waste heat boilers, marine boilers, nuclear containers, pressure vessels, engineering machines, and seal mechanical equipment.
